Ruth Peetoom (born July 25, 1967 in Breda ) is a Dutch evangelical pastor and politician of the Christian Democratisch Appèl (CDA).

Life

Ruth Peetoom studied Protestant theology and ethics at the Vrije Universiteit Amsterdam . She works as a pastor in the Protestant Church in the Netherlands in Utrecht. Since 2011, Peetoom has succeeded Liesbeth Spies as party leader of the Christian Democratisch Appèl. Peetoom is married to the CDA politician René Paas and lives in Utrecht .
